During one of the sessions at the Roundtable, John made a statement: “Statements can impact you but questions can change your life.” As I sat and listened to some amazing leaders like Chris Hodges of Church of the Highlands, Robert Morris of Gateway Church, and Todd Mullins of Christ Fellowship Church, these are some of the HARD questions that hit my mind:

1. What boundaries has God given me for ministry? If He gave Israel boundaries for their country and where not to go, do we have boundaries? Can we reach too far to places He did not give us?

2. Do I see the value in people?

3. Am I really experiencing silence and solitude?

4. What was the last Word the Lord gave me?

5. Do I work harder at growing myself inside than I do outside?

6. Will I finish well, and what does that look like?

7. Am I a leader driven by the Presence of the Lord?

8. What am I doing that will bring supernatural results?

9. Am I an extravagant giver?

These questions may not impact you, but they left me grappling with God. I have to admit I did not like some of my answers. I used to be an extravagant giver; not so much today. That hurt – I guess it’s easy to live off of yesterday’s manna.

As you can tell I had some repenting to do. I also have some changes to make. See, questions really can change your life.
